Webhook retries on Pennyvale: we retry failed deliveries five times with exponential backoff, capping at 15 minutes. After that, events land in the dead-letter queue and need a manual replay — don't just re-trigger the release, it won't help. If a partner reports missing events post-release, check the replay dashboard first. When filing the replay job, quote the trace token shown below.

session token of tajef-bageg = htk21_5d90d574934f3ccae6437

Action item: The Relayn deploy-status bot silently dropped updates when the pipeline API paginated results, so responders believed a rollback had completed when it had not. We will add pagination handling, a staleness banner, and an integration test. Until merged, verify deploy state directly in the pipeline console, documented at the page below.

runbook for kahop-kajop: https://rundeck.ordinio.test/display/secrets/pipeline/issue/pages/repo/browse/e5732776e07d1285107e5aeb

Handover note — Marla Venn to Doust Kerrick

As I step back from operations, the open item is the Lintvale plant. Line 3 runs at 91% utilisation; demand forecasts for the Kessler valve range suggest we exceed capacity by Q3. Options costed so far: second shift (lower capex, higher labour risk) or the Brantham annex build-out. Finance should model both against the revised volume plan. The wider strategic context is summarised below.

management briefing: Headcount on the Gilael team goes from 37 to 118 by the end of October. Gross margin on Gilael came in at 26 percent against a plan of 45 percent.

Subject: DR drill notes — Harrowfield telemetry gateway

Team, the quarterly drill for the Plowline gateway completed without incident. Failover to the Ostmark site took nine minutes; tractor telemetry backfilled cleanly. For future maintainers: restoring the cold-standby node requires the vault passphrase, which we agreed to record here after each drill.

strongbox words: norwyn-wenael-aldvan-aldiel-wendor-holael